1//===--------------------- RegisterFileStatistics.cpp -----------*- C++ -*-===//2//3//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ions.4// See https://llvm.org/LICENSE.txt for license information.5//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ception6//7//===----------------------------------------------------------------------===//8/// \file9///10/// This file implements the RegisterFileStatistics interface.11///12//===----------------------------------------------------------------------===//13 14#include "Views/RegisterFileStatistics.h"15#include "llvm/Support/Format.h"16 17namespace llvm {18namespace mca {19 20RegisterFileStatistics::RegisterFileStatistics(const MCSubtargetInfo &sti)21    : STI(sti) {22  const MCSchedModel &SM = STI.getSchedModel();23  RegisterFileUsage RFUEmpty = {0, 0, 0};24  MoveEliminationInfo MEIEmpty = {0, 0, 0, 0, 0};25  if (!SM.hasExtraProcessorInfo()) {26    // Assume a single register file.27    PRFUsage.emplace_back(RFUEmpty);28    MoveElimInfo.emplace_back(MEIEmpty);29    return;30  }31 32  // Initialize a RegisterFileUsage for every user defined register file, plus33  // the default register file which is always at index #0.34  const MCExtraProcessorInfo &PI = SM.getExtraProcessorInfo();35  // There is always an "InvalidRegisterFile" entry in tablegen. That entry can36  // be skipped. If there are no user defined register files, then reserve a37  // single entry for the default register file at index #0.38  unsigned NumRegFiles = std::max(PI.NumRegisterFiles, 1U);39 40  PRFUsage.resize(NumRegFiles);41  llvm::fill(PRFUsage, RFUEmpty);42 43  MoveElimInfo.resize(NumRegFiles);44  llvm::fill(MoveElimInfo, MEIEmpty);45}46 47void RegisterFileStatistics::updateRegisterFileUsage(48    ArrayRef<unsigned> UsedPhysRegs) {49  for (unsigned I = 0, E = PRFUsage.size(); I < E; ++I) {50    RegisterFileUsage &RFU = PRFUsage[I];51    unsigned NumUsedPhysRegs = UsedPhysRegs[I];52    RFU.CurrentlyUsedMappings += NumUsedPhysRegs;53    RFU.TotalMappings += NumUsedPhysRegs;54    RFU.MaxUsedMappings =55        std::max(RFU.MaxUsedMappings, RFU.CurrentlyUsedMappings);56  }57}58 59void RegisterFileStatistics::updateMoveElimInfo(const Instruction &Inst) {60  if (!Inst.isOptimizableMove())61    return;62 63  if (Inst.getDefs().size() != Inst.getUses().size())64    return;65 66  for (size_t I = 0, E = Inst.getDefs().size(); I < E; ++I) {67    const WriteState &WS = Inst.getDefs()[I];68    const ReadState &RS = Inst.getUses()[E - (I + 1)];69 70    MoveEliminationInfo &Info =71        MoveElimInfo[Inst.getDefs()[0].getRegisterFileID()];72    Info.TotalMoveEliminationCandidates++;73    if (WS.isEliminated())74      Info.CurrentMovesEliminated++;75    if (WS.isWriteZero() && RS.isReadZero())76      Info.TotalMovesThatPropagateZero++;77  }78}79 80void RegisterFileStatistics::onEvent(const HWInstructionEvent &Event) {81  switch (Event.Type) {82  default:83    break;84  case HWInstructionEvent::Retired: {85    const auto &RE = static_cast<const HWInstructionRetiredEvent &>(Event);86    for (unsigned I = 0, E = PRFUsage.size(); I < E; ++I)87      PRFUsage[I].CurrentlyUsedMappings -= RE.FreedPhysRegs[I];88    break;89  }90  case HWInstructionEvent::Dispatched: {91    const auto &DE = static_cast<const HWInstructionDispatchedEvent &>(Event);92    updateRegisterFileUsage(DE.UsedPhysRegs);93    updateMoveElimInfo(*DE.IR.getInstruction());94  }95  }96}97 98void RegisterFileStatistics::onCycleEnd() {99  for (MoveEliminationInfo &MEI : MoveElimInfo) {100    unsigned &CurrentMax = MEI.MaxMovesEliminatedPerCycle;101    CurrentMax = std::max(CurrentMax, MEI.CurrentMovesEliminated);102    MEI.TotalMovesEliminated += MEI.CurrentMovesEliminated;103    MEI.CurrentMovesEliminated = 0;104  }105}106 107void RegisterFileStatistics::printView(raw_ostream &OS) const {108  std::string Buffer;109  raw_string_ostream TempStream(Buffer);110 111  TempStream << "\n\nRegister File statistics:";112  const RegisterFileUsage &GlobalUsage = PRFUsage[0];113  TempStream << "\nTotal number of mappings created:    "114             << GlobalUsage.TotalMappings;115  TempStream << "\nMax number of mappings used:         "116             << GlobalUsage.MaxUsedMappings << '\n';117 118  for (unsigned I = 1, E = PRFUsage.size(); I < E; ++I) {119    const RegisterFileUsage &RFU = PRFUsage[I];120    // Obtain the register file descriptor from the scheduling model.121    assert(STI.getSchedModel().hasExtraProcessorInfo() &&122           "Unable to find register file info!");123    const MCExtraProcessorInfo &PI =124        STI.getSchedModel().getExtraProcessorInfo();125    assert(I <= PI.NumRegisterFiles && "Unexpected register file index!");126    const MCRegisterFileDesc &RFDesc = PI.RegisterFiles[I];127    // Skip invalid register files.128    if (!RFDesc.NumPhysRegs)129      continue;130 131    TempStream << "\n*  Register File #" << I;132    TempStream << " -- " << StringRef(RFDesc.Name) << ':';133    TempStream << "\n   Number of physical registers:     ";134    if (!RFDesc.NumPhysRegs)135      TempStream << "unbounded";136    else137      TempStream << RFDesc.NumPhysRegs;138    TempStream << "\n   Total number of mappings created: "139               << RFU.TotalMappings;140    TempStream << "\n   Max number of mappings used:      "141               << RFU.MaxUsedMappings << '\n';142    const MoveEliminationInfo &MEI = MoveElimInfo[I];143 144    if (MEI.TotalMoveEliminationCandidates) {145      TempStream << "   Number of optimizable moves:      "146                 << MEI.TotalMoveEliminationCandidates;147      double EliminatedMovProportion = (double)MEI.TotalMovesEliminated /148                                       MEI.TotalMoveEliminationCandidates *149                                       100.0;150      double ZeroMovProportion = (double)MEI.TotalMovesThatPropagateZero /151                                 MEI.TotalMoveEliminationCandidates * 100.0;152      TempStream << "\n   Number of moves eliminated:       "153                 << MEI.TotalMovesEliminated << "  "154                 << format("(%.1f%%)",155                           floor((EliminatedMovProportion * 10) + 0.5) / 10);156      TempStream << "\n   Number of zero moves:             "157                 << MEI.TotalMovesThatPropagateZero << "  "158                 << format("(%.1f%%)",159                           floor((ZeroMovProportion * 10) + 0.5) / 10);160      TempStream << "\n   Max moves eliminated per cycle:   "161                 << MEI.MaxMovesEliminatedPerCycle << '\n';162    }163  }164 165  TempStream.flush();166  OS << Buffer;167}168 169} // namespace mca170} // namespace llvm171
